Table of Contents

Class ModelExtension

Namespace
OpenAI.Extensions
Assembly
AntRunnerLib.dll
public static class ModelExtension
Inheritance
System.Object
ModelExtension
Inherited Members
System.Object.Equals(System.Object)
System.Object.Equals(System.Object, System.Object)
System.Object.GetHashCode()
System.Object.GetType()
System.Object.MemberwiseClone()
System.Object.ReferenceEquals(System.Object, System.Object)
System.Object.ToString()

Methods

ProcessModelId(IOpenAiModels.IModel, String, String, Boolean)

public static void ProcessModelId(this IOpenAiModels.IModel modelFromObject, string modelFromParameter, string defaultModelId, bool allowNull = false)

Parameters

modelFromObject IOpenAiModels.IModel
modelFromParameter System.String
defaultModelId System.String
allowNull System.Boolean